Kwame: The Taxi Driver Turned Entrepreneur

 

Kwame, a taxi driver in Accra, Ghana, found himself overwhelmed by debt. His daily earnings barely covered his living expenses and debt repayments. Instead of giving up, Kwame decided to leverage his local knowledge and driving skills. He saved enough money to buy a second-hand car and joined ride-hailing platforms like Bolt and Uber.

Through hard work and dedication, Kwame managed to repay his debts and expand his business. Today, he owns a fleet of cars and employs several drivers. Kwame’s story demonstrates that with the right mindset and strategic use of available resources, financial freedom is within reach.

Amina: The Small-Scale Farmer’s Transformation

Amina, a small-scale farmer in Nigeria, struggled with debt due to poor harvests and fluctuating market prices. Rather than cutting back on farming expenses, Amina sought out agricultural extension services to learn modern farming techniques and crop diversification.

By implementing these new methods, Amina improved her yields and started growing high-demand crops. She also ventured into value addition by processing and packaging her produce. Her increased income allowed her to pay off her debts and invest in her farm. Amina’s journey shows that innovation and continuous learning can lead to financial stability.

Joseph: The Teacher’s Side Hustle

Joseph, a secondary school teacher in Kenya, was overwhelmed by debts from personal loans and family obligations. Despite his modest salary, Joseph decided to explore side hustles to supplement his income. He began tutoring students in the evenings and on weekends, offering extra classes in subjects like mathematics and science.

Over time, his reputation as a dedicated tutor grew, and so did his income. Joseph was able to pay off his debts and even save enough to start a small business selling educational materials. His story underscores the power of leveraging one’s skills to create additional income streams.

Fatima: The Craftswoman’s Online Business

Fatima, a talented craftswoman in Tanzania, was facing mounting debts due to medical expenses and the high cost of living. Traditional advice suggested finding a better-paying job, but Fatima chose to harness her creative skills. She started making jewelry and home décor items from recycled materials.

Using social media platforms like Instagram and Facebook, Fatima marketed her products to a broader audience. Her unique and eco-friendly creations gained popularity, and orders started pouring in. The increased revenue enabled her to clear her debts and expand her business. Fatima’s experience highlights the potential of turning a hobby into a profitable venture.

 

Samuel: The Mobile Money Agent

Samuel, a young man in Uganda, was burdened with debt after a failed business venture. Rather than giving up, Samuel saw an opportunity in the growing mobile money market. He became a mobile money agent, facilitating transactions for people in his community who lacked access to traditional banking services.

Samuel’s business quickly took off as more people relied on his services for their financial needs. With the steady income from transaction fees, Samuel was able to pay off his debts and save for the future. His story illustrates that identifying and capitalizing on emerging opportunities can pave the way to financial freedom.

Practical Tips for Your Financial Freedom Journey

  1. Leverage Your Skills: Like Joseph and Kwame, identify and monetize your skills through side hustles or business ventures.
  2. Innovate and Diversify: Follow Amina’s example by adopting new techniques and diversifying your sources of income.
  3. Utilize Technology: Use social media and online platforms to market your products or services, as Fatima did.
  4. Identify Emerging Opportunities: Look for new market trends and opportunities, similar to Samuel’s mobile money venture.
